Q: Is 24,312,966 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 24,312,966 is a composite number.

Why is 24,312,966 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 24,312,966 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 647 1,294 1,941 3,882 6,263 12,526 18,789 37,578 4,052,161 8,104,322 12,156,483 and 24,312,966, with no remainder.

Since 24,312,966 cannot be divided by just 1 and 24,312,966, it is a composite number.
